In the previous Elder Scrolls titles, your skill choices at character creation would determine how fast skills increase. Skyrim removes the character creation aspect and instead gives you the Guardian Stones to choose a set of skills to increase faster. The new system has advantages in that it is simple and it allows you to change your character's focus over time. However, it is also bad because it lacks flexibility, and having the Guardian Stones co-exist with the other 10 standing stones means that you are forced to choose between skill increases and gameplay abilities, which makes no sense!
Skill specialization in Skyrim is mainly done through the Perk system, and this mod was designed to keep that pattern consistent. It implements a new skill learning system which is inspired by the old class system from Morrowind, but the skill choices are now tied to Perks instead of being determined by character creation or Standing Stones. In addition, the Guardian Stones have been reworked and various tweaks have been made to the Standing Stones in order to improve them.
TL;DR: Perks give skill bonuses, Guardian Stones give gameplay bonuses. Other Stones have been tweaked.
Dynamic Skill Specialization
Skill learning modifiers are determined by a combination of the level of the skill and investment in the primary Perks of the corresponding tree. Each skill is accordingly classified as Major (35% XP bonus), Minor (normal XP), or Auxiliary (20% XP penalty*). At low levels, only the first Perk is required for a Major Skill, but at higher levels, further investment is needed.
*If you prefer Auxiliary skills to gain no XP, set DSS_HardcoreMode to 1 either in the in-game console or in the plugin itself.
These transitions work as follows:
- Start: 1st Perk required for Major Skill
- Skill level 40+: 2nd Perk required for Major Skill, 1st Perk required for Minor Skill
- Skill level 60+: 3rd Perk required for Major Skill, 2nd Perk required for Minor Skill
- Skill level 80+: 4th Perk required for Major Skill, 3rd Perk required for Minor Skill
Note that for the Smithing tree, Perks on either side of the tree can count as primary Perks.

Resting Bonuses
Since the resting bonuses are intertwined with skill learning and Standing Stones, some tweaks have been made to them to improve general quality of life. The vanilla bonuses were a bit too low and didn't last long enough to feel worthwhile, and requiring marriage for the best bonus creates an awkward clash between gameplay and roleplay motivations.
Rested: All skills improve 8% faster for 16 hours.
Well Rested: All skills improve 15% faster for 16 hours.
Lover's Comfort: All skills improve 15% faster, and buying and selling prices are 5% better for 16 hours.

Ability Condition Bug
It is possible that on a long-running save, your Major Skills will get stuck and fail to change when they should. They will likely still update on certain triggers, like changing equipment. It is recommended that you install Bug Fixes to fix the bug. If you can't use that mod for whatever reason, follow these steps:
- Disable the mod and load your game.
- Save your game and exit.
- Re-enable the mod and load your game again.
Compatibility
Almost all Perk mods require a patch, which may include functionality or just descriptions, depending on how much is changed. Standing Stone mods can be used on top of this mod by loading them later in your load order. Everything else should be trivially compatible.
- Andromeda - Unique Standing Stones of Skyrim - Partially compatible. Load after this mod so it overwrites the Standing Stones. Dynamic skill specialization will be retained.
- Ordinator - Perks of Skyrim - Patch available. Dynamic skill specialization is reworked so that you need both ranks of the base Perk for a Major Skill; this does not scale.
- Survival Mode - Compatible. The Lover Stone ability will be slightly different from Lover's Comfort, but everything else will work correctly.
- Vokrii - Patch available.
